A man has invested ₹50,500 at a rate of 6% per annum simple interest for 2 years. Find the amount (in ₹) that he will receive after 2 years.

Given:
Principal (P) = ₹50,500
Rate (R) = 6% per annum
Time (T) = 2 years
Simple Interest = $\frac{P \times R \times T}{100}$
= $\frac{50500 \times 6 \times 2}{100}$
= $\frac{50500 \times 12}{100}$
= 50500 × 0.12 = ₹6060
Amount = Principal + Interest
= 50500 + 6060
= ₹56,560
Final Answer:
₹56,560
